[0010] Figure 1 shows a control device 1 that can be used in any electronic application. The application to motor vehicles is particularly advantageous, since in the manufacture of motor vehicles mass production, high successful savings (Einsparerfolg) can be achieved overall with small savings potentials (Einsparpotenzial) per product by means of modifications. The control device according to the invention is particularly advantageous for use in parking assistance for motor vehicles, wherein not only data communication takes place by means of a control device of this type, but also time measurement for distance measurement is carried out in the control device. The invention will therefore be explained below using the example of a control device for a parking assistance in a motor vehicle.

The invention relates to a control device with a microprocessor and with interfaces (14, 15, 16, 17, 28, 30), characterized in that the data processing through the microprocessor (2) and the data communication through the interfaces (14, 15, 16, 17, 28, 30) only pass through the internal ring resonance of the microprocessor (2) device (4) to provide clock pulses.

technical field [0001] The invention relates to a control device of the type described in the independent claims and to a method for operating the control device. Background technique [0002] In particular, a control device is known for measuring the distance of a motor vehicle to obstacles surrounding the motor vehicle, wherein an external oscillator is connected to the control device for supplying the control device with a clock signal. In particular, a crystal oscillator with a crystal resonator, which can emit a frequency signal very precisely, is used here. In addition to the crystal oscillator, other passive components, such as resistors or capacitors, are usually required for connecting the crystal oscillator.
